I"ve got a dx160. the only problem I have with it is the three point lift. wont go down, its in a bind somewhere. Hydraulics are a bit touchy sometimes and need to be cycled a time or two to get them to work. It"s got lots of muscle and always runs cool even in the hay fields on a hot oklahoma day. Biggest gripe I have is where do I get parts and who owns them this week???????? The cab is a bit short especially in a rough field!!!!!! I would buy another one if I could find a reliable source for parts.
